Let the diameter be d cm
As we know that
Circumference of circle with diameter d is πd
Given Circumference of a circle is 44 cm
⟹πd=44

7
22

×d=44
⟹d=
22
44×7

=14
So the diameter is 14 cm

For Mean = 73.19, Mode = 79.56 and Variance = 16, the Karl Pearson's Coefficient of Skewness will be -0.0256 -1.64 0.0256 0

Answers

Answer:

To calculate Karl Pearson's coefficient of skewness, we need to use the formula:

Skewness = 3 * (Mean - Mode) / Standard Deviation

Given the Mean = 73.19, Mode = 79.56, and Variance = 16, we need to find the Standard Deviation first.

Standard Deviation = √Variance = √16 = 4

Now we can substitute the values into the formula:

Skewness = 3 * (73.19 - 79.56) / 4

Skewness = -6.37 / 4

Skewness = -1.5925

Rounded to four decimal places, the Karl Pearson's coefficient of skewness for the given values is approximately -1.5925.

The mean life of a new smart LED bulb is 20,000 running hours with a standard deviation is 2,250 hours. The data is normally distributed. If a home improvement store sold 18,000 of these light bulbs in the first year of production, how many light bulbs would you expect to last longer than 22,250 hours?

Answers

Answer: The expected number of bulbs that would last longer than 22,250 hours is approximately 2,857.

Step-by-step explanation:

To solve this problem, we can start by finding the z-score for 22,250 using the formula:z = (x - mean) / standard deviationz = (22,250 - 20,000) / 2,250 = 1Next, we need to find the proportion of bulbs lasting longer than 22,250. We can look up this proportion in a standard normal distribution table or use a calculator, which gives us a probability of 0.1587.Finally, we can use this probability to find the expected number of bulbs that will last longer than 22,250:Expected number of bulbs = probability * total number of bulbs sold Expected number of bulbs = 0.1587 * 18,000 = 2,857Therefore, we can expect that approximately 2,857 of the 18,000 bulbs sold will last longer than 22,250 running hours.
